Ottawa, Canada, December 16, 2004 - TenXc Wireless Inc., an innovator in intelligent radio frequency solutions for enhanced wireless network capacity and quality, today announced the appointment of Graham Belcher as the Vice President of Engineering.Graham brings over 30 years of wireless industry experience in RF product design, base-station development, and network deployment of wireless systems.Graham will be responsible for leading and growing TenXc's development and engineering organization to deliver on TenXc's Intelligent RF vision.
"Graham's proven engineering and leadership expertise in taking multiple next generation wireless technologies to commercial reality will be instrumental in our drive to bring product to market," said Joseph Hickey, President and CEO of TenXc Wireless.

"We are excited to have a high caliber individual in Graham as TenXc moves to capitalize on the market opportunity and provide carrier-grade solutions to our wireless service provider customers."
Graham has served in numerous senior management and engineering positions with Lucent Technologies, AT&T, and Bell Laboratories, delivering solutions to major wireless customers.At Lucent Technologies Graham was Director, WCDMA Base-station Hardware Design, and had held senior management positions associated with GSM, GPRS and UMTS products.He played a leading role in the design and implementation of the first US Cellular System in Chicago in 1978 and has been working with evolving wireless technologies ever since.
Graham has lived and worked in North America, Europe and the Middle East.He holds a Masters degree in Electrical Engineering from Rutgers University and is a Member of the Institution of Electrical Engineers.
